NIDCOM Confirms documentation of 10th batch of Sudan evacuees.

The Chairman of the Nigerians in Diaspora Commission (NIDCOM), Mrs Abike Dabiri-Erewa, has confirmed that the tenth batch of evacuees from Sudan are already done with their documentation.

Dabiri-Erewa stated this today while issuing an update on the next batch of Nigerian citizens that would be coming into the country from the war-ravaged Sudan.

Meanwhile, the NiDCOM said that a total number of 1,730 Nigerians have returned from Sudan with the latest flight from Port Sudan bringing in 146 evacuees aboard the Tarco Airline.

The NiDCOM spokesman, Abdur-Rahman Balogun, disclosed that the flight landed at Nnamdi Azikiwe International Airport at five minutes past ten in the morning on Tuesday while giving an extensive update on the returnees so far.
